Continental Tires Americas Hires Head of Bicycle
Continental Tires the Americas, LLC, based in Fort Mill, SC, said Shane Messner joined the company as head of Bicycle the Americas timed with the company’s recently announcing it is ramping up its presence in the U.S. and Canada with QBP as a new distribution partner.

Nike Opens New Store in Tokyo Focused on Running
The purpose for Nike Ginza is to serve local runners at all levels and connect them to one another. In Japan, this is channeled through competitive relay running, a passion that’s visible from late fall through winter during Ekiden season.
Vista Outdoor Gets Antitrust Nod for Ammo Business Sale
Vista Outdoor, Inc. reported that the deal to merge its sporting products business with Czechoslovak Group a.s. has cleared the antitrust clearance period under the Hart-Scott-Rodino Antitrust Improvements Act of 1976.
Puma to End Sponsorship of Israel’s National Football Team in 2024
Puma will end its sponsorship of Israel’s national football team in 2024, a decision the brand said was made before Hamas’ October 7 attack. Puma has faced boycotts over its sponsorship.
Nordstrom Names Chief Information Security Officer
Nordstrom named Nicole Ford as chief information security officer. Previously, Ford was VP and CISO at Rockwell Automation, with experience guiding security transformation initiatives and developing cybersecurity programs.
Fleet Feet Opens Ninth Store in Missouri
Fleet Feet announced a new store was opened in Jefferson City, MO, by owner/operator Nancy Yaeger, who also owns Fleet Feet Columbia. The opening marks the ninth Fleet Feet store in the state.

Strava Appoints Former Nike Exec as CEO
The company hired Michael Martin as CEO, replacing outgoing CEO, Michael Horvath. Martin will also join the Strava Board upon assuming the role on January 2, 2024. Currently, Martin serves as the GM of YouTube Shopping.
